Output 59d5a9cb0b796baf46f6948e727fbd30255f4566f00c6672707475d56a6ed8c8:0

value
400109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81561837ed5c39cb68c92c01fd2eb4ec4f22128c OP_EQUAL
address
3DUtEFKpn7oRaKiXSdVHEygd6jyn9unmNr
transaction
59d5a9cb0b796baf46f6948e727fbd30255f4566f00c6672707475d56a6ed8c8
confirmations
182796
spent
true